What is the CRP Test?

The C-Reactive Protein test, often referred to as the CRP test, is a valuable tool in the realm of healthcare. This test measures the levels of C-reactive protein in your blood. But what exactly is C-reactive protein, and why is it important?

C-reactive protein is produced by your liver in response to inflammation. When there's an infection or injury in your body, this protein increases, making it a useful marker to gauge inflammation. Understanding the CRP test can help diagnose and monitor various health conditions.

Purpose of the CRP Test

Detecting Infections

The CRP test plays a crucial role in identifying infections in the body. When bacteria or viruses invade, your immune system reacts by increasing C-reactive protein levels. Elevated CRP levels in your blood can signal an ongoing infection, prompting your doctor to investigate further.

Assessing Autoimmune Diseases

Autoimmune diseases, such as rheumatoid arthritis, lupus, and psoriasis, involve your immune system mistakenly attacks healthy tissues. The CRP test can aid in the diagnosis and management of these conditions. High CRP levels in autoimmune diseases can indicate disease activity and guide treatment decisions.

Monitoring Inflammatory Bowel Disease

Inflammatory bowel diseases like Crohn's disease and ulcerative colitis cause chronic inflammation in the digestive tract. The CRP test is valuable for monitoring disease activity and assessing the effectiveness of treatment in these conditions.

Tracking Chronic Stress

Chronic stress can take a toll on your body. It can lead to inflammation, and the CRP test can help assess the impact of stress on your health. High CRP levels in individuals with chronic stress may warrant lifestyle changes and stress management strategies.

CRP Test Results

CRP test results are typically reported in milligrams per liter (mg/L) of blood. The interpretation of these results depends on the context of the test and the specific condition being investigated. Here's a general guideline for understanding CRP test results:

- Low CRP Levels (Under 1 mg/L): Low CRP levels are considered normal in healthy individuals. It suggests a low risk of infection or inflammation.

- Moderate CRP Levels (1 to 10 mg/L): Moderate CRP levels may indicate mild inflammation. This range can be associated with a variety of conditions, and further evaluation is often necessary to determine the cause.

- High CRP Levels (Above 10 mg/L): High CRP levels are a strong indicator of significant inflammation. This could be due to an infection, autoimmune disease, or other underlying health issues.

It's important to note that CRP results should always be interpreted by a healthcare professional in the context of your overall health and medical history. Depending on the situation, your doctor may recommend additional tests and investigations to pinpoint the exact cause of elevated CRP levels.

A. Several factors can cause C-reactive protein levels to rise, including: 1. Infections: Bacterial or viral infections can trigger an immune response, leading to increased CRP levels. 2. Inflammatory Conditions: Autoimmune diseases like rheumatoid arthritis, lupus, and psoriasis can result in chronic inflammation and elevated CRP. 3. Inflammatory Bowel Disease: Conditions like Crohn's disease and ulcerative colitis cause inflammation in the digestive tract, raising CRP levels. 4. Chronic Stress: Prolonged stress can lead to inflammation and subsequently elevate CRP levels. 5. Tissue Injury: Physical injury or trauma can temporarily increase CRP as part of the body's natural healing process.

A. A CRP level of 10 mg/L or higher is generally considered dangerously high and should be a cause for concern. However, the interpretation of CRP levels can vary based on individual health, medical history, and the context in which the test is performed. It's crucial to consult a healthcare professional to determine the significance of elevated CRP in your specific situation.

A. C-reactive protein itself does not cause symptoms. Instead, elevated CRP levels are a sign of an underlying issue, such as inflammation, infection, or disease. The symptoms associated with high CRP levels depend on the underlying cause. For example: - Infections may present with symptoms like fever, chills, and localized pain. - Inflammatory conditions like rheumatoid arthritis can lead to joint pain and swelling. - Chronic stress may manifest as fatigue, sleep disturbances, and mood changes. It's important to focus on identifying and addressing the root cause of high CRP levels, as treating the underlying issue often alleviates associated symptoms. How Inflammation Affects Overall Health: Understanding the Hidden Risks

Inflammation is often misunderstood. While it is a vital protective response of the immune system, persistent or chronic inflammation can quietly damage tissues and increase the risk of serious diseases. Understanding how inflammation affects overall health is crucial in preventing long-term complications and maintaining optimal wellbeing.

According to the World Health Organization and global medical research published in Lancet, chronic inflammation is linked to a wide range of non-communicable diseases, including heart disease, diabetes and autoimmune disorders.

 

What Is Inflammation?

Inflammation is the body’s natural response to:

  • infection

  • injury

  • toxins

  • stress

It activates immune cells to eliminate harmful stimuli and promote healing.

There are two main types:

Acute Inflammation

Short-term and protective.
Examples include swelling after injury or fever during infection.

Chronic Inflammation

Long-term, low-grade inflammation that persists even without injury.

Chronic inflammation is harmful.

 

How Chronic Inflammation Develops

Persistent inflammation can result from:

  • unhealthy diet

  • sedentary lifestyle

  • obesity

  • chronic stress

  • environmental toxins

  • untreated infections

Modern lifestyle patterns contribute significantly to this condition.

 

Impact on Heart Health

Inflammation damages blood vessels and promotes plaque formation.

This increases risk of:

  • heart attack

  • stroke

  • hypertension

ICMR data highlights cardiovascular disease as a leading cause of death in India, with inflammation playing a contributing role.

 

Link Between Inflammation and Diabetes

Chronic inflammation interferes with insulin signalling.

This leads to:

  • insulin resistance

  • elevated blood sugar

  • metabolic syndrome

NFHS-5 data shows rising diabetes prevalence, partly linked to inflammatory lifestyle factors.

 

Effect on Joint and Muscle Health

Inflammatory processes contribute to:

  • arthritis

  • joint stiffness

  • muscle pain

Autoimmune diseases often involve chronic inflammation.

 

Gut Health and Inflammation

The gut plays a central role in immune regulation.

Poor diet and stress disrupt gut balance, triggering:

  • inflammatory bowel conditions

  • digestive discomfort

  • nutrient malabsorption

Gut inflammation impacts systemic health.

 

Brain Health and Inflammation

Emerging research suggests chronic inflammation affects:

  • memory

  • mood

  • cognitive performance

Inflammatory markers are associated with depression and neurodegenerative disorders.

 

Chronic Fatigue and Inflammatory Stress

Persistent inflammation causes:

  • ongoing fatigue

  • reduced stamina

  • sleep disturbances

The immune system remains in constant activation mode.

 

Role in Autoimmune Disorders

Autoimmune diseases occur when the immune system mistakenly attacks healthy tissues.

Chronic inflammation is central to conditions such as:

  • rheumatoid arthritis

  • lupus

  • inflammatory bowel disease

Lifestyle Factors That Increase Inflammation

High Sugar Intake

Excess sugar promotes inflammatory pathways.

 

Processed Foods

Trans fats and additives trigger immune responses.

 

Sedentary Lifestyle

Lack of exercise reduces anti-inflammatory benefits.

 

Poor Sleep

Sleep deprivation increases inflammatory markers.

 

Chronic Stress

Elevated cortisol disrupts immune balance.

 

Natural Ways to Reduce Inflammation

Anti-Inflammatory Diet

Include:

  • leafy greens

  • fruits rich in antioxidants

  • nuts and seeds

  • whole grains

Avoid excessive processed foods.

 

Regular Physical Activity

Exercise lowers inflammatory markers and improves circulation.

 

Stress Management

Meditation and breathing exercises reduce stress hormones.

 

Adequate Sleep

7–8 hours of quality sleep supports immune regulation.

 

Maintain Healthy Weight

Excess abdominal fat produces inflammatory chemicals.
